According to Nick Anton, owner of La Perla, 734 S. 5th St., the restaurant's expansion will open right after Summerfest.
Anton bought the building next door -- the old Brass Light Gallery manufacturing plant -- after the gallery consolidated its retail and manufacturing operations in their space at 131 S. 1st St.
The La Perla expansion is 4,500 sq. ft. and includes a brand new kitchen, expanded menu and late-night dining until 1 a.m. The menu boasts more quesadillas, shrimp and jalapeno martinis, and new margarita flavors including peach, mango, melon, watermelon and more.
Husband-wife team Tom Littmann and Demetra Copoulos created the interior design. (Copoulos designed the mechanical pepper in the original space.) It features glass garage doors, horseshoe-shaped booths and a rooftop patio that's already open for business.
Anton also plans to have salsa dancing and weekend djs spinning Latin beats.
"Hopefully we'll have a lot of dancing, both on the floor and on the bar top like in South Beach," says Anton. "We're really trying to promote the Latin Quarter."
